UPSC CAPF Assistant Commandant 2026 Registration Ends Tomorrow, Details Inside

The registration period for the UPSC CAPF Assistant Commandant 2026 examination is set to conclude tomorrow, March 12. Aspirants must ensure that their applications are submitted by this deadline to be eligible for the exam, which is provisionally slated for July 19, 2026. This recruitment drive aims to fill 349 vacancies across various branches of the Central Armed Police Forces, including the Border Security Force (BSF), Central Reserve Police Force (CRPF), and others. Candidates are encouraged to review the eligibility criteria and prepare accordingly, as the competition is expected to be fierce. The UPSC (Union Public Service Commission) is responsible for conducting this prestigious examination, which serves as a gateway for candidates aspiring to serve in key leadership roles within India's paramilitary forces.
